Transaction e8fc4e22435a8e14406b0ad12563b4204782802f694a5723cab0e4f81cc7b0f5
1 Input
1 Output
-
e8fc4e22435a8e14406b0ad12563b4204782802f694a5723cab0e4f81cc7b0f5:0
- value
- 42423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bf228a5863a315735f58d0d3bda0b63eeafcd1e OP_EQUAL
- address
- 3ESywhFrjAhAMGR8sVsw3hGXMx5VqMLSHy